Lakefront Utility Services Inc. (LUSI) is located in the Town of Cobourg on Lake Ontario, half an hour east of Oshawa. As a multi-service utility provider, Lakefront is proud to provide reliable and cost-effective electric, water and fibre distribution services in the Town of Cobourg. Manager Engineering and Operations
The Manager of Engineering & Operations provides leadership, direction and support to a small team of technical staff and have accountability for all aspects of distribution system asset management, including short and long-term planning and design, system capacity forecasting, metering, customer connections and operations, and will ensure work is completed in a timely manner in accordance with all applicable rules and regulations and procedures set out by LUSI.
Overall Responsibilities:
- Manage the construction and maintenance of the overhead and underground electric distribution system.
- Prepare and execute distribution system plans, including capital, maintenance and metering.
- Establish capital and operating budgets and create schedules for the electric distribution system in the areas of expansions, connections and enhancements.
- Design distribution system customer connections, including cost estimates, offer-to-connects, work order, municipal approval packages, material lists, tenders and RFP’s, etc.
- Responsible for the quality and quantity of work, maintenance of work schedules and safety of all personnel working under their supervision, and the safety of the public.
- Manage the construction and verification program, ensuring work completion with established construction, material standards and specifications for the electric distribution system, in compliance with O. Reg 22/04.
- Manage the capital workflow processes ensuring optimum efficiency in delivering expansion, connection and enhancement projects in the Distribution Department.
- Ensure there are processes in place to provide a timely and effective response to system breakdowns and outages.
- Administer and facilitate the connection of distributed energy resources to the electric distribution system including interfacing on all aspects from connection requirements to commissioning.
- Establish and maintain construction and material standards and specifications for the electric distribution system.
- Develop long-range planning studies, including research of load growth patterns for capacity and guidelines for new development including Conditions of Service.
- Manage the electric metering assets and daily operations which includes maintaining and prioritizing work plans for meter re-verification, new meter installs, meter communication issues, electronic meter programming, records, etc.
- Manage the operation, updating and maintenance of the distribution GIS, SCADA, and utility owned fiber network.
- Coordinate safe and efficient work practices and procedures of all staff and external contract resources in the execution of distribution system capital and maintenance plan.
- Engage your team to innovate and evolve the electric distribution system capabilities through automation, enhanced optimization, and provide recommendations for further efficiencies and performance.
- Prepare reports for and attend board meetings updating the progress, performance and objectives.
- Approval of timecards, vacation requests and employee expenses.
- Other duties as assigned.
Qualifications:
- Require a designation as a Professional Engineer or Certified Engineering Technologist (P.Eng., CET). and a registered member of OACETT registered in the province of Ontario.
- A minimum of five years of electrical engineering management experience in an electric distribution utility environment.
- Possess an in-depth knowledge of a distribution system, specifically with respect to the design and operation of overhead and underground distribution systems, metering systems and generator connections.
- Working knowledge of technical specifications and standards including CSA, CEA, ESA and IHSA regulations.
- Demonstrated knowledge of GIS, SCADA, OMS, AMI software systems, AutoCAD drafting and MS Office applications.
- Demonstrated ability to lead a technical team of staff members, facilitating growth, development, and commitment.
- Fluency in Project Management disciplines for project scope, budget and schedules.
- An ability to manage effectively in a team environment and to coordinate multiple projects to meet deadlines.
- Must have a working knowledge of the Collective Agreement and company policies.
- Sound understanding of Occupational Health and Safety Act and Regulations, (OH&SA) EUSR book and Safe Practice Guides, Utility Work Protection Code (UWPC), Temporary Conditions, Book 7, and any other applicable legislation.
